  The   World Economic Forum speculates the world could be short 13 million nurses by 2030. There are various reasons for this, with exhaustion, burnout and mistreatment ranking the top three. The shortage of nurses in the ICU has been a problem for several years. However, the issue has become an even bigger problem because of the COVID-19 pandemic. Some of the most common reasons driving critical care nurses to leave include excessive workload, distress, and burnout.
